Grindaleitet is a hill in Alver Municipality, Western Norway and has an elevation of 120 metres. Grindaleitet is situated nearby to the hamlet Eikemo, as well as near the locality Vike.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Vike Church is a parish church of the Church of Norway in Alver Municipality in Vestland county, Norway. It is located in the village of Vikanes, along the Romarheimsfjorden. Vike Church is situated 3½ km southeast of Grindaleitet.
